CSP launches TCA Float ultra-low density material for automotive body panels

The new sheet molding compound (SMC) material is said to reduce part weight by up to 25% while maintaining mechanical properties and Class A surface finish.

A Corvette C8 decklid molded from CSP’s new TCA Float.  This material is said to provide a sub-1.0 specific gravity density with a Class A surface that is also e-coat oven capable. When used as a direct replacement for TCA Ultra Lite, it can result in weight savings of up to 25%. Source | CSP

CSP’s Advanced Materials team (Auburn Hills, Mich., U.S.) introduces TCA Float, an ultra-lightweight sheet molding compound (SMC) material for automotive body panel applications.

TCA Float is said to offer a sub-1.0 specific gravity (SpG) density and is reported to be the first sub-1.0 material available on the market to provide a truly paintable Class A surface.

TCA Float is 23% lighter than CSP’s award-winning TCA Ultra Lite, but similar in strength, so that the new material can be used as a direct replacement in current designs and applications without changes to existing tooling or manufacturing processes while maintaining surface quality and paintability. 

For comparison, 24 body panels of a current production vehicle are being molded with TCA Ultra Lite. If these 24 panels were molded using TCA Float instead, it would result in a mass savings of more than 24 kilograms.

CSP reports that the ultra-low density of this material is achieved while maintaining critical mechanical properties, paint adhesion and bond strength.

“We are constantly looking for ways to make our materials lighter, stronger and more sustainable,” explains Mike Siwajek, vice president, Research & Development. “TCA Float was named because our intention was to create a material so light it would literally float on water. This material provides an ultra-lightweight solution where a Class A surface is needed, but part weight is a consideration, especially for something like a removable roof panel. Ultimately, TCA Float improves upon our TCA portfolio with the same base resin chemistry that has allowed us to be the industry leader in Class A SMC for over twenty years.”
